2006 exgo TXT PDS key switch- F/R selector
Ok new member..I have no idea from this point...Lost my mind..in my dash of the ezgo TXT I have the direct positive and negative from the pack with voltage(pack voltage 40.3) next is the F/R selector switch with Orange(Forward) Grey(neutral) Green (reverse) ...past that I have a 2 pole ignition switch with a white wire and a white:Yelliw wire ... I have ran the wiring every way I can think of in my head but am lost...the way it was, the pos and negative were directly wired to volt meter then a jumper off the positive side of that to the key switch and the colors to the F/R selector then the white and white/yellow on one pole and the positive jumper on the other pole...found the batt meter was bad so i replace that, the key switch and the F/R switch all at the same time the key switch lugs were corroded figured will be better, with nothing connected no batt meter, no key switch installed yet i connected the F/R switch and flipped to reverse and have the back up buzzer and cart moves..flip to forward same thing place the switch in neutral and nothing happens... so my selector switch is my drive control...?????I want the key to work and make sure cart is dead without a key(kids don’t need to drive it with nobody around)all wiring from 10 pin have continuity..the 4 pin for switch on accelerator pedal all has continuity and have variable speeds...the pins for the motor all have continuity to the lugs on the motor housing. all have continuity to the speed controller and that is working properly...so why would I have movement of the cart with just the selector switch and no key/volt meter hooked up...It must be something simple and I am losing my mind or I am screwed and it is the controller....Hopefully someone can take me farther than I have gone...Thanks in advance

Re: 2006 exgo TXT PDS key switch- F/R selector
Gray isn't the neutral wire on the F/R switch, it is the common wire (B+ input). You've also got the color code for the F and R wires swapped. In F the Gray wire is connected to the Green wire and in R it is connected to the Orange wire.
The controller supplies both B+ and B- to the solenoid and under conditions the controller can energize the solenoid whenever the Run/Tow switch is in Run. Basically, the PDS is a drive-by-wire system. so to troubleshoot it, you have to find out what the controller is being told to do. If it is being told to make the cart go when it shouldn't be told to do so, then it is a problem in the control wiring and external switches. On the other hand, if the controller is not being to to make the cart go and it is, it is a controller problem. Attached is a schematic with the wires needed to have battery pack voltages on them to tell controller to make cart move, highlighted. Also attached is a drawing of the keyswitch without headlights, a drawing of the voltage paths through the controller and a picture showing Pin-1 on all the jacks. |

Re: 2006 exgo TXT PDS key switch- F/R selector
Quote:
The F/R switch is before the keyswitch, so there will be voltage on the gray wire whether the key is on or off. To get voltage to the keyswitch, a direction must be selected on the F/R switch. If the cart runs without the key being on, the keyswitch has been bypassed somehow. The drawing I posted with the voltage paths through the controller highlighted should enable you to find the problem. |

Re: 2006 exgo TXT PDS key switch- F/R selector
Just an update JohnnieB had me in the right direction so i took the 10 pin harness out along with the wiring and followed the schematic...exactly and found the solenoid was jumped with a wire ... just after purchasing it i took a picture of the wiring and put it back as it was....well not so much a good thing...took all wires out and rewired solenoid and 10 pin correctly and whammo only runs with the key on and that is good...Thank you all👍👍👍👍
